Output 76d4c99180ab57233cd56e300353d4b248430f6c0d878fe30f9edb69bf509c96:1

value
16485596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ef436682a6e19beacf74aae32f9399350f165a77 OP_EQUAL
address
3PW8ATMoSAmkFVdBenVJU3kKUY7i4GjNuo
transaction
76d4c99180ab57233cd56e300353d4b248430f6c0d878fe30f9edb69bf509c96
spent
true